
State two conditions for a beam balance to be true.

Hint: A beam balance is a device that is used to measure the weights of different objects, it can also be used to compare weights of two different objects. It works on the principle of moments. According to principle of moments the clockwise moments due to standards weights on the right side of the beam balance is equal to the anti-clockwise moment due to weight of the object on the right side of the beam balance.
Complete step by step answer:
A beam balance determines an unknown mass by balancing a known mass.
For a beam balance to be true, there are two major points to be remembered.
1) Both the arms of the beam balance that is the left and the right arm must be of equal lengths.
2) Both the pans or base on which the weights are to be measured must be of equal weight.
Additional Information:
There are many types of balances used nowadays to determine even slightest change in weight like, ultra micro, semi micro , micro, analytical and precision balance.
Different types of balances used in laboratories are, Top Loading balance, analytical balance, portable balances, semi micro balances and micro balances.
Note:
A beam balance is generally used for calibrating the masses in the range between 1kg and 10mg. The precision of the beam balance generally depends on the sharpness of the knife edge and its quality that the pivot is formed of.
